Why Starmer won't rule out a wealth tax
July 09, 2025 · 29 min

At today's PMQs, Labour leader Keir Starmer refused to rule out a new wealth tax.

Leader of the Opposition Kemi Badenoch demanded a cast-iron guarantee that there won’t be an autumn Budget raid on wealth, but the Prime Minister couldn’t give one, fuelling Tory claims that a “toxic cocktail” of Labour tax rises could be on the way.

Tim Stanley and Gordon Rayner are joined by Daily Telegraph Economics Reporter Emma Taggart to discuss what a potential 2% wealth tax on assets over £10 million, suggested by Labour grandee Lord Kinnock, could mean for savers, homeowners, and the British economy.

And if you visit Heathrow this summer, Grammy-nominated artist Jordan Rakei has turned the airport’s everyday noises into a four-minute ambient soundscape designed to soothe travellers. But will it calm the nerves of our resident anxious flyer Tim Stanley?
